Blue Owl Real Estate Net Lease Trust has raised approximately USD 164.6 million through the sale of 15.46 million common shares, according to a filing submitted to the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). 
The transaction was completed earlier this week, with the trust issuing and selling 15.46 million common shares as part of its capital-raising activities. Details of the transaction were disclosed through a regulatory filing reviewed by Reuters. 
The share sale provides the real estate investment trust with additional capital that can be deployed across its investment activities, including portfolio expansion, property acquisitions, debt management and other corporate purposes, subject to the trust’s investment strategy and capital allocation plans. 
Blue Owl Real Estate Net Lease Trust operates within the broader Blue Owl Capital platform, which has established a presence across alternative asset classes including real estate, private credit and other investment strategies. Net lease real estate portfolios typically focus on properties leased to tenants under long-term agreements, generating stable rental income streams for investors. 
The latest equity raise comes at a time when many real estate investment vehicles continue to evaluate funding options amid changing interest rate expectations and evolving capital market conditions. Access to public and private capital remains a key factor for real estate trusts seeking to maintain investment activity and portfolio growth. 
The SEC filing did not provide additional operational updates beyond the disclosure of the share sale transaction.
